#60e5d3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#60e5d3 is composed of 37.6% red, 89.8% green and 82.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 7.9%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 171.9 degrees, a saturation of 71.9% and a lightness of 63.7%. #60e5d3 color hex could be obtained by blending #c0ffff with #00cba7.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

#60e5d3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#60e5d3 has RGB values of R:96, G:229, B:211 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0, Y:0.08,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 6350291.

Shades and Tints of #60e5d3
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020a09 is the darkest color, while #f8fefd is the lightest one.
